5.3.4.3
Normal mode with crystal reference
In the normal mode with crystal reference, the FMPLL receives an input clock frequency from the crystal
oscillator and the pre-divider, and multiplies the frequency to create the FMPLL output clock. The user
must supply a crystal that is within the appropriate frequency range, the crystal manufacturer
recommended external support circuitry, and short signal route from the MCU to the crystal.
In normal mode with crystal reference, the FMPLL can generate a frequency-modulated clock or a
non-modulated clock (locked on a single frequency). The modulation rate, modulation depth, output
divider (RFD) and whether the FMPLL is modulating or not can be programmed by writing to the FMPLL
registers. The system clock divider (SYSDIV) can also be used to further reduce the system clock
frequency in addition to the FMPLL output divider. The system clock divider can be programmed by
writing to SIU_SYSDIV[SYSDIV]. See
Section 16.6.31, System Clock Register (SIU_SYSDIV)
for
details.
NOTE
The PLL output frequency (before the system clock divider) must not
exceed the maximum device operating frequency. Therefore, when
operating at the maximum operating frequency, the only division factor
allowed in the system clock divider is divide-by-1.
